For a listing of employee benefits, please visit us at www.texaspetrochemicals.com POSITION SUMMARY : Responsible for administration and processing of bi-weekly and semi-monthly payrolls. Will be responsible for quality payroll services for all TPC employees which will include responding to employee questions and assisting employees in obtaining information related to all aspects of payroll activity. Serves as a liaison to external payroll processing form (ADP) in regard to all payroll questions including tax or other withholding related issues. Works closely with plant personnel related to time and attendance input and verification. Assists in resolution of payroll related issues/problems, and delivers quality customer service.
